>   On Thu, Aug 19, 2021 at 23:04, Taste-Of-IT<kontakt at taste-of-it.de> wrote:   Hello,
> 
> i have two nodes with a distributed volume. OS is on a separate disk which crashed on one node. However i can reinstall the os and the raid6 which is used vor the distributed volume was rebuild. The question now is, how to re-add the brick with the volume back to the existing old volume. 
> 
> If this is not possible what is with this idea: i create a new vol2 with distributed over both nodes and move the files direkt from directory to new volume via nfs-ganesha share?!
